Choosing the Right Dry Dog Food for Lipomas: A Buyer’s Guide

Finding the best dry dog food when your furry friend has lipomas (fatty lumps) is important. While diet cannot cure lipomas, good nutrition can support your dog’s overall health. This guide helps you pick the right kibble.

Key Features to Look For

What should I look for on the bag?

  • Lower Fat Content: Since lipomas are fat deposits, choosing a food with moderate to lower overall fat levels is usually recommended. Aim for foods where the fat percentage is clearly listed and reasonable for your dog’s needs.
  • High-Quality Protein: Lean protein sources help maintain muscle mass without adding unnecessary fat. Look for named meats like “chicken,” “beef,” or “salmon” as the first ingredient.
  • Fiber Rich Ingredients: Fiber helps dogs feel full, which can aid in weight management. Weight control is key when dealing with fatty tumors. Look for ingredients like sweet potatoes, peas, or brown rice.
  • Omega-3 Fatty Acids: These healthy fats, often found in fish oil, support skin, coat, and overall cellular health. They are generally beneficial for dogs with any health issue.

Important Ingredients and Materials

What ingredients are best for dogs with lipomas?

The best food uses whole, recognizable ingredients. Avoid foods packed with fillers. Good materials include:

  • Named Meat Sources: Chicken meal, turkey, or fish.
  • Complex Carbohydrates: Brown rice, oats, or barley offer steady energy.
  • Healthy Fats: Small amounts of flaxseed or fish oil for Omega-3s.
What ingredients should I avoid?

You want to reduce the intake of ingredients that contribute heavily to overall body fat. You should try to limit:

  • Excessive or unnamed animal fats (“animal fat”).
  • High amounts of corn or soy, especially if they are the primary ingredients.
  • Artificial colors, flavors, and unnecessary chemical preservatives.

Factors That Improve or Reduce Food Quality

How does the quality of the food affect lipomas?

High-quality food promotes a healthy metabolism. A healthy weight reduces strain on the body. When a dog maintains a healthy weight, the growth or prominence of existing lipomas might be less noticeable.

What makes a food better?

A food is better when the ingredients are highly digestible. Easily digestible food means your dog uses the energy efficiently. Look for foods with clearly stated nutrient profiles verified by organizations like AAFCO (Association of American Feed Control Officials).

What makes a food worse?

Foods loaded with cheap fillers hurt quality. If the first few ingredients are corn or wheat byproducts, the food offers less nutritional value. Poor quality can lead to weight gain, which is not ideal for a dog managing lipomas.

User Experience and Use Cases

How do owners use this food?

Owners typically use specialized dry food as the main diet for their dog. They mix it with water to soften it slightly if needed. The goal is to transition the dog slowly to the new food over about a week to prevent stomach upset.

What should I expect from the results?

Remember, diet change is a supportive measure. You might see improved coat shine or better energy levels due to better nutrition. Owners often report that their veterinarian approves of the lower-fat, high-fiber diet choice.


10 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) About Dry Dog Food for Lipomas

Q: Can special food make my dog’s lipomas disappear?

A: No. Diet supports overall health, but it usually does not eliminate existing fatty lumps. Talk to your vet about treatment options.

Q: How low should the fat content be in the food?

A: This depends on your dog’s specific needs. Generally, look for foods around 10% to 14% fat on a dry matter basis, but always follow your veterinarian’s specific advice.

Q: Is grain-free food better for lipomas?

A: Not necessarily. Grain-free doesn’t automatically mean low-fat. Focus on the total fat percentage and quality of ingredients, not just whether grains are present.

Q: Should I feed my dog less food overall?

A: Yes, managing total calorie intake is crucial for weight control. Measure portions carefully according to your vet’s recommendation.

Q: What is the most important nutrient to monitor?

A: You should monitor the total fat content and ensure you are getting adequate lean protein.

Q: Are prescription diets necessary?

A: Sometimes your vet may recommend a therapeutic or prescription diet if your dog has other concurrent issues like pancreatitis or severe obesity.

Q: How long does it take to see dietary benefits?

A: You might notice better skin and coat health within a few weeks. Changes related to weight management take several months of consistent feeding.

Q: Can I still give my dog treats?

A: Yes, but treats must be low-fat. Use small pieces of lean cooked chicken or vet-approved low-fat training treats.

Q: Does the kibble size matter?

A: Kibble size mainly affects how fast your dog eats. Slowing down eating can aid digestion, but it does not directly affect the lipomas themselves.

Q: What should I do if my dog refuses the new low-fat food?

A: Transition very slowly, mixing small amounts of the new food with the old food. If refusal continues, consult your vet for alternative palatable options.
